Os trechos do GEdit não parecem funcionar em arquivos remotos?

Os trechos do GEdit não parecem funcionar em arquivos remotos?

Estou tentando usar o plugin "snippets" do gedit. Eles funcionam muito bem no Ubuntu, mas desde então mudei para o Debian. Agora, embora eu tenha habilitado os Snippets, eles não funcionam quando estou editando arquivos em um servidor remoto (SFTP).

Eles funcionam muito bem localmente (criar arquivo, definir idioma como PHP, testar trechos), o que é pouco confortável, já que prefiro trabalhar no servidor remoto.

Isso é um bug no gedit Debian? Estou usando o Squeeze.

Etapas de reprodução (usando Debian Squeeze 6.0.2):

  • No gedit, habilite Snippets (Editar -> Preferências -> Plugins -> Marque "Snippets")
  • Abra uma nova conexão SFTP no nautilus (Places -> Home -> Ctrl-L -> sftp://any.site.that/you/can/access/through/SFTP
  • Clique duas vezes em um arquivo php para abri-lo no gEdit
  • Digite "foreach" e pressione tab. O restante do código deverá ser preenchido automaticamente. Observe que isso não ocorre.
  • Abra um novo documento (Ctrl-N)
  • Defina o idioma (na parte inferior) de "Texto simples" para "PHP"
  • Digite "foreach" e pressione tab. Observe que o restante do códigofazpreencher automaticamente agora.

Responder1

Para resumir os comentários, o gedit parece funcionar corretamente em relação aos snippets quando invocado em um contexto "normal".

Ele só parece ter um problema quando invocado clicando duas vezes em um arquivo remoto, para que ele seja executado com um diretório remoto como o atual. Isso indica um bug bastante intrigante no gedit.

O autor da postagem apresentou, portanto, umarelatório de erro. A última entrada datada de 18/10/2011 diz:

Muitas correções foram feitas em trechos na versão 3.2.0 e
seria bom testar isso nessa versão.

informação relacionada